Sleep Apnea and Car Crashes

Sleep deprivation isn’t just a direct threat to a person’s health; it also makes normal activities riskier. People with OAS are not always aware that their quality of sleep is suffering. They may wake up with jaw pain as a result of their jaws moving forward in an attempt to keep their airways open, and they may snore, but they may not be taken fully out of sleep several times per night. However, the new research found that people with mild OAS are 13% likelier to cause a car accident and that people with severe OAS are 123% likelier. Worse, once people are sleep deprived, they have difficulty determining whether their impairment is mild or severe.


Custom-fitted oral appliances that ease bruxism reduce one source of a patient’s sleep disruption. People with sleep apnea can drive safely if they are undergoing treatment, which is why patients should help their dentists and sleep doctors to work together.
